Argyll and Bute Council has a vacancy for a ferry operative - 2nd person to cover the evening passenger only service on the ferry that travels between Cuan and Luing.

The hours are an average of 11 per week (annualised over 12 months), worked over a 2 week rota.

During the winter timetable, which runs for 40.07 weeks from late August to early June the working pattern is;

Week 1 - Monday, Tuesday, Wednesday, Saturday 19.20 to 22.20 (12.5 hours)

Week 2 - Monday, Tuesday, Wednesday, Thursday, Friday 19.20 to 22.20 (15.5 hours).

The position requires the following certificates:

  • Seafarer medical report form ML5 and ML5 certificate (MSF 4112)
  • Basic Sea Survival (STCW Code – Table A-VI/1-1)
  • Fire Fighting & Prevention (STCW Code - Table A-VI/1-2)
  • Elementary First Aid (STCW Code – Table A –VI/1-3)
  • Personal Safety & Social Responsibilities (PSSR) (STCW Code - Table A-VI/1-4)
